Crawlspace Sealing in Fort Collins, CO

Crawlspace sealing services involve the installation of barriers and insulation to close gaps, cracks, and vents in a building’s crawlspace area. This process helps prevent outside air, moisture, pests, and debris from entering the space, which can contribute to mold growth, wood rot, and higher energy costs. Projects typically include sealing around vents, pipes, and ducts, as well as insulating walls and floors to improve energy efficiency and indoor air quality. Homeowners considering crawlspace sealing often want to understand how the process can reduce drafts, control humidity, and protect the foundation from potential damage.

Before requesting crawlspace sealing, property owners usually seek information about the scope of work needed for their specific space, the types of materials used, and how the sealing will impact energy bills and indoor comfort. It’s also common to inquire about the condition of the existing crawlspace, such as signs of moisture or pest activity, to determine if additional repairs or moisture control measures are necessary. Clear understanding of these factors can help homeowners make informed decisions about improving their home's durability and efficiency.

Common Crawlspace Sealing Jobs

Foundation and crawlspace sealing - helps prevent drafts and improves energy efficiency in homes.

Moisture barrier installation - reduces the risk of mold growth and wood rot in the crawlspace.

Air leak sealing - minimizes the entry of dust, pests, and outdoor allergens into living spaces.

Vapor barrier replacement - enhances indoor air quality by controlling humidity levels.

Insulation sealing - boosts comfort by maintaining consistent temperatures throughout the home.

Crawlspace vent sealing - prevents unwanted airflow and helps stabilize indoor climate conditions.

Crawlspace Sealing Questions

What is crawlspace sealing? Crawlspace sealing involves closing gaps and vents to prevent air, moisture, and pests from entering the space beneath a home.

Why should homeowners consider crawlspace sealing? Sealing can improve indoor air quality, reduce energy costs, and protect the foundation from moisture damage.

What materials are used for crawlspace sealing? Common materials include vapor barriers, sealant tapes, and insulation to ensure a tight and secure enclosure.

Is crawlspace sealing suitable for all homes? It is typically beneficial for homes with exposed or unsealed crawlspaces, especially in areas prone to moisture issues.
